Сжатие речи на основе алгоритма векторного квантования
Состав работы
|
|
|
|
Работа представляет собой zip архив с файлами (распаковать онлайн), которые открываются в программах:
- Microsoft Word
Описание
В данной курсовой работе представлена разработка алгоритма функционирования системы, обеспечивающей сжатие речи с помощью векторного квантования, и программная реализация алгоритма в системе MATLAB и на языке С.
Приводится исследование влияния на работоспособность системы аддитивных шумов, разработка и исследование программной реализации системы на основе ЦПОС. Разработана система сжатия речи, обеспечивающая сжатие речи до уровня 2400 бит/с и ниже и и подсистема декодирования в реальном времени с помощью алгоритма векторного квантования. Предусмотрены несколько ступеней сжатия. Обеспечена работа системы в двух режимах: дикторо-зависимом и дикторо-независимом. Система реализована в пакете MATLAB и на языке С.
СОДЕРЖАНИЕ
Введение
1. Постановка задачи
2. Описание существующих методов сжатия речи
3. Описание выбранного метода сжатия
4. Разработка программы на MATLab
5. Тестирование на MATLab
6. Системные требования
Заключение
Библиографический список
Приложение А. Текст программы на MATLab
Приложение Б. Текст программы на С
ВВЕДЕНИЕ
При передаче речи по цифровым каналам связи, будь то сотовая или Интернет-телефония, самый важный вопрос - это сколько информации (число бит в единицу времени) придется передавать по каналам, чтобы снабдить пользователя качественной голосовой связью. Ответ на него в каком-то смысле определяет все - стоимость и качество предоставляемых пользователям услуг и аппаратуры, емкость и масштабируемость сети передачи данных и многое другое.
Сжатие речи при ее передаче сокращает объем передаваемых данных, затраты и, благодаря этому, позволяет снижать цены на услуги и привлекать новых пользователей. Именно поэтому рынок цифровой телефонии развивается под непосредственным технологическим диктатом ученых и разработчиков кодеков речи.
Очевидно, что, начиная с каких-то пороговых значений соотношения скорости передачи и доступной емкости каналов, операторы связи имеют достаточную (для развития и своего, и рынка) прибыль. В настоящее время можно сказать, что этот порог уже превышен. Это привело к тому, что расценки на цифровую связь стали более чем конкурентны по сравнению с проводной аналоговой, а благодаря скорому переходу к кодекам речи на скорости порядка 2,4 кбит/с и ниже, цена минуты междугородного разговора может в ближайшие годы снизиться до нескольких центов за минуту.
Сказав про успехи, нельзя не сказать хотя бы пару слов и о недостатках. Качество звучания сжатой речи, что в сотовой, что в Интернет-телефонии оставляет желать лучшего. Некоторые (из тех, кто имеет такой выбор) до сих пор предпочитают аналоговые сотовые сети цифровым, поскольку в последних речь часто звучит механически, случаются посторонние звуки и т. п. - и все из-за сжимающих кодеков речи, так как в остальном цифровые протоколы передачи обеспечивают лучшее качество звучания. В компьютерной телефонии снижению качества, помимо кодеков речи, способствует заметное запаздывание сигнала и ошибки при сборке пакетов. Впрочем, понятно, что если с кодеком на 2,4 кбит/с "узкий" канал справляется с трудом, то на скорости 1,2 кбит/с проблем будет меньше. Да и пропускная способность компьютерных сетей возрастает настолько быстро, что в ближайшей перспективе сетевая задержка снизится в несколько раз. И тогда и у пользователей, и у операторов на первое место могут встать высокие требования именно к низкоскоростным кодекам речи.
Приводится исследование влияния на работоспособность системы аддитивных шумов, разработка и исследование программной реализации системы на основе ЦПОС. Разработана система сжатия речи, обеспечивающая сжатие речи до уровня 2400 бит/с и ниже и и подсистема декодирования в реальном времени с помощью алгоритма векторного квантования. Предусмотрены несколько ступеней сжатия. Обеспечена работа системы в двух режимах: дикторо-зависимом и дикторо-независимом. Система реализована в пакете MATLAB и на языке С.
СОДЕРЖАНИЕ
Введение
1. Постановка задачи
2. Описание существующих методов сжатия речи
3. Описание выбранного метода сжатия
4. Разработка программы на MATLab
5. Тестирование на MATLab
6. Системные требования
Заключение
Библиографический список
Приложение А. Текст программы на MATLab
Приложение Б. Текст программы на С
ВВЕДЕНИЕ
При передаче речи по цифровым каналам связи, будь то сотовая или Интернет-телефония, самый важный вопрос - это сколько информации (число бит в единицу времени) придется передавать по каналам, чтобы снабдить пользователя качественной голосовой связью. Ответ на него в каком-то смысле определяет все - стоимость и качество предоставляемых пользователям услуг и аппаратуры, емкость и масштабируемость сети передачи данных и многое другое.
Сжатие речи при ее передаче сокращает объем передаваемых данных, затраты и, благодаря этому, позволяет снижать цены на услуги и привлекать новых пользователей. Именно поэтому рынок цифровой телефонии развивается под непосредственным технологическим диктатом ученых и разработчиков кодеков речи.
Очевидно, что, начиная с каких-то пороговых значений соотношения скорости передачи и доступной емкости каналов, операторы связи имеют достаточную (для развития и своего, и рынка) прибыль. В настоящее время можно сказать, что этот порог уже превышен. Это привело к тому, что расценки на цифровую связь стали более чем конкурентны по сравнению с проводной аналоговой, а благодаря скорому переходу к кодекам речи на скорости порядка 2,4 кбит/с и ниже, цена минуты междугородного разговора может в ближайшие годы снизиться до нескольких центов за минуту.
Сказав про успехи, нельзя не сказать хотя бы пару слов и о недостатках. Качество звучания сжатой речи, что в сотовой, что в Интернет-телефонии оставляет желать лучшего. Некоторые (из тех, кто имеет такой выбор) до сих пор предпочитают аналоговые сотовые сети цифровым, поскольку в последних речь часто звучит механически, случаются посторонние звуки и т. п. - и все из-за сжимающих кодеков речи, так как в остальном цифровые протоколы передачи обеспечивают лучшее качество звучания. В компьютерной телефонии снижению качества, помимо кодеков речи, способствует заметное запаздывание сигнала и ошибки при сборке пакетов. Впрочем, понятно, что если с кодеком на 2,4 кбит/с "узкий" канал справляется с трудом, то на скорости 1,2 кбит/с проблем будет меньше. Да и пропускная способность компьютерных сетей возрастает настолько быстро, что в ближайшей перспективе сетевая задержка снизится в несколько раз. И тогда и у пользователей, и у операторов на первое место могут встать высокие требования именно к низкоскоростным кодекам речи.
Другие работы
Универсальное устройство для снятия и установки колес (для трактора)
proekt-sto
: 22 января 2021
Разработанное устройство установки и снятия колес позволяет сократить временные и физические затраты.
Описанная технология работы устройства, а также результаты расчета на прочность позволяют сделать вывод о том, что устройство является достаточно надежным и может использоваться для производства работ по техническому обслуживанию и ремонту. Устройство достаточно просто в применении и не требует специальных навыков, может использоваться не только в ремонтной мастерской но и при необходимости в лю
700 руб.
Истина Православия
Qiwir
: 30 августа 2013
Hикoлaй Бepдяeв. Истина Православия
Христианский мир мало знает Православие. Знают только внешние и по преимуществу отрицательные стороны Православной Церкви, но не внутренние, духовные сокровища. Православие было замкнуто, лишено духа прозелетизма и не раскрывало себя миру. Долгое время Православие не имело того мирового значения, той актуальной роли в истории, какие имели Католичество и Протестантизм. Оно оставалось в стороне от страстной религиозной борьбы ряда столетий, столетия жило под ох
5 руб.
Лабораторная работа №2 по дисциплине: Теория электрических цепей. Вариант 9
SibGOODy
: 6 апреля 2023
Лабораторная работа №2
Исследование активных RC фильтров
Цель работы: исследование амплитудно-частотных характеристик фильтра нижних частот третьего порядка, реализованного на пассивных и активных RC-звеньях.
Таблица 2.1 - Исходные данные
Вариант: 9
dА, дБ: 1,0
Amin, дБ: 29
f2, кГц: 25
f3, кГц: 68,7
400 руб.
КТИ СИБГУТИ РЕФЕРАТ Главные значения термина цивилизация
loututu
: 9 августа 2025
РЕФЕРАТ
Главные значения термина цивилизация
Когда возникла первая в истории цивилизация
Какие этапы проходит цивилизация как общество
Что такое христианская цивилизация
180 руб.